What happened next to Peterborough United’s promotion-winning class of 2000 including a matchwinner who ended up working on a market stall

Peterborough United celebrated a promotion from the Third Division 20 years ago this week (May 26, 2000).

Posh beat Darlington 1-0 at Wembley under the management of Barry Fry.

Here’s what happened next to that successful Posh team.

Posh: Mark Tyler, Richard Scott, Adam Drury (sub Ritchie Hanlon, 44 mins), Andy Edwards, Simon Rea, Steve Castle, Jon Cullen, Gareth Jelleyman, David Farrell, David Oldfield, Andy Clarke (sub Francis Green, 89 mins). Unused subs: Bart Griemink, centre-back Matthew Wicks and midfielder Matthew Gill.
